What “compliance-ready QA” actually means

Financial institutions and fintechs operate under layered expectations: internal controls for financial reporting, PCI scope for card flows, and operational resilience scrutiny. While no tool replaces your GRC program or auditor relationship, engineering teams still need traceable records that tie changes to validation.

Release velocity in banking and payments keeps increasing; the gap is rarely “more manual tests” and more often provable coverage, segregation between environments, and audit trails that hold up when teams are distributed.

Sector realities

Evidence on demand

Internal audit and regulators expect to reconstruct what was validated for a release—not a best-effort recap.

Change volume

Hotfixes and regulatory patches ship often; lightweight but consistent test records reduce last-minute scrambles.

Third-party and integration risk

Core systems talk to many APIs; end-to-end scenarios need clear ownership and outcomes.

Role clarity

Separation between who approves, who deploys, and who signs off on quality should be reflected in how work is tracked.
